LEADER PRICE ... no one has mentioned Leader Price ..it's right across the road from Cadisco ... LP is a popular food market in France. Many of the locals in the vicinity of Simply Market use this facility. We live for two months @ Mont Vernon; I walk 15-20 minutes to LP and can find nearly all our needs. 1) If you're looking for America "stuff" forget it! .it's French 2) Alcohol of all sort is very economical. Wine bargains: In France, Leader Price is considered the place to buy your daily wine, 3) Packaged French cheese and meats are A-1. 4) follow the French locals around the Frozen foods (meats, fish, veg) to see what they're buying 5) Baguettes, French pasties are delivered very morning fresh, often hot 6) Because we are on an island, fresh veg., fruit are delivered by container; therefore, daily shopping will inform you. Not tons of choice, but daily! Eggs are Free Range and delicious.
Our gang at Mont Vernon on Orient Beach shop at Leader Price daily!
